Description:

Bryozoan? velvety and fairly solid mass growing under water along branches and cables fairly near the surface, observed in our Portland-area Columbia River marina, not sure whether it might be sea creature eggs or something akin to coral, or a Bryozoan...

Habitat:

under water, not far from surface, where we've observed it, growing along under water branches and cables

Notes:

We've noticed this growing in several spots in our marina, on the Columbia River, this August, and wonder what it is... coral? fish eggs?
